    graydog
    Wife & I have two 6255i's. Mine developed crack along outside of one hinge. Very carefully superglued it back with C-clamp holding crack closed. I then sanded off about 1/2 of the thickness of it; covered with epoxy and sanded back to original thickness. It's fine so far (has been about two months). It looks original now. I didn't care about that but just wanted it not to break completely off. Not a job for the faint of heart though.

    Evidently, a mfg. defect. They all seem to be doing it.

    PTCO911
    I purchased a Nokia 6255i in June 05 and a second for my wife in August 05. They have both developed cracks along the top hinges. One has cracks along the seams of the outer part of the hinges, the second has started cracking along the inner larger part of the hinge. I have turned one into Nokia for repair, but haven't been advised as to whether it is covered under warranty.

    Is this a know issue with this particular model? I sent an email to Nokia regarding this and was advised they were unaware of it. They were my first two Nokias and more than likely the last. I love the phone's features but they don't do much good if the phone falls apart or spends most of its time in repair.
